Thirteen years ago, the Los Angeles Fire Department prepared for dangerous winds with red flag warnings of gusts up to 90 mph, deploying extra fire engines to high-risk areas like the Palisades. However, in January 2022, the LAFD failed to take similar precautions, leading to the Palisades fire escalating beyond control despite life-threatening wind alerts. Former LAFD officials criticized the decision to not deploy additional engines and maintain a full firefighter shift, emphasizing the importance of proactive measures in tackling potential wildfires during extreme weather conditions.

Trump’s birthright citizenship order is unconstitutional, appeals court says
A federal appeals court ruled that President Trump's executive order limiting birthright citizenship is unconstitutional, stating it contradicts the Fourteenth Amendment. The Ninth Circuit's decision, which followed a lower court's ruling, allows states to challenge the order, asserting it risks financial harm and likely violates the Constitution, despite the Trump administration's arguments to the contrary.
